Sat 1372553988899697

decimal
339021.1488899697
degree
0°129021′333″1488899697‴
percentile
65.35971382902414%
name
ecylpanlkfw
cycle
0
epoch
1
period
168
block
339021
offset
1488899697
timestamp
rarity
common